Landscape grading and resloping include improving the surface to enhance drainage, prevent erosion, and develop aesthetically appealing outdoor areas. Proper grading directs water away from structures, lowers pooling, and supports healthy plant development. The procedure starts with examining the existing topography, soil type, and preferred water circulation. Heavy machinery or hand grading may be used to change slopes, level areas for yards, and produce practical spaces such as balconies or pathways. Resloping likewise supports long-lasting landscape health by avoiding soil erosion, lowering stress on plants, and preserving proper drainage. Well-executed grading makes sure structural stability, enhances aesthetic appeal, and safeguards the home from water-related damage
